Key Features of Fitness Apps for Teens
While considering the world of fitness apps available for teenagers, it’s crucial to explore the features that make them effective tools for health monitoring. One prominent aspect is their intuitive interface, allowing easy navigation for users who may not be tech-savvy. User-friendliness ensures teens can maximize the functionality of these apps. Additionally, compatibility with various devices, including smartphones and wearables, boosts accessibility, allowing fitness tracking on the go. Another key feature is the ability to set personal goals, letting teens choose what they aim to achieve. Many apps support customizable plans, factoring in diverse fitness levels and interests. The social connectivity features stand out, allowing friends to connect and motivate each other. This networking provides valuable emotional support crucial during challenging fitness journeys. Moreover, tailored nutrition tracking helps teens understand their dietary habits and make healthier choices, which synergizes with fitness goals. Many applications include instructional videos that demonstrate workouts, ensuring users perform exercises safely. Overall, the enhanced design and functionality cater specifically to this audience, which can lead to better engagement and stronger commitment in maintaining a fitness regimen.

One challenge with relying on technology for fitness among teenagers is potential screen time overload. While apps offer engaging content, it’s vital that users maintain balance, ensuring physical exercises happen offline. Parents and guardians should be vigilant in monitoring how their teens use these applications, encouraging breaks and emphasizing the importance of real-world interactions. Facilitating a well-rounded routine allows teenagers to experience both the digital benefits and the advantages of traditional fitness, like team sports or outdoor activities. Furthermore, privacy and data security concerns are essential when utilizing fitness apps. It is important to ensure safe practices, especially when it comes to sharing information. Parents can take proactive steps to educate their teens about staying safe online and safeguarding personal information. Ultimately, by incorporating moderation, technology can complement traditional approaches to fitness. Striking a balance between app use and real-time physical activities supports healthier lifestyles. Facilitated connections through technology should enhance community engagement, not replace it.
